Chinkiang Postage Dues Trial Prints of Second Issue Overprint in Red: ½c. rose-red in a block of four with two pairs of the overprint tête-bêche, cancelled by the circular "chinkiang/postal agency" handstamp; part hinge remainders on the reverse. Photo All examples of the trial printing should have been destroyed. This was certified as having been done by Roger de Villard. However, the appearance of these used stamps and philatelic covers on the market resulted in de Villard being jailed for defrauding the Chinkiang Local Post
